THE BEATLES The Beatles' Story (Rare 1972 UK BBC Transcription Service radio show vinyl 2-LP set presented by Brian Matthew, Part 1 is subtitled 'The Birth Of The Liverpool Sound' and Part 2 is subtitled 'Getting It On Wax' and includes interviews and snippets of different songs by various artists from the time including tracks by The Beatles. Housed in the original yellow die-cut sleeves complete with cue sheets which lists 53 songs with the length the track features in the show and also lists copyright details for each track - one of the all time rarest transcriptions shows to find!) more...

THE BEATLES Notts/Derby/Staffs/Lincs/Norfolk Newsletter (Rare 1971 UK Official Beatles Fanclub newsletter issued for the Nottingham/Derby/Staffs/Lincs/Norfolk area in September of that year by Deborah Graham, Area Secretary. These featured information taken from the more common National Newsletter along with local information for Fan Club activities in the area. This issue is a double sided A4 sheet talking about many things including the Bangladesh concert & the birth of Stella, still in the original mailing envelope dated 1st October!) more...
